body{
font:normal 70.5% "Trebuchet MS", Arial, Helvetica, sans-serif;
background-image:url(../images/back.png);
margin:0;
padding:0;
}
#container{
margin:0 auto;
width:800px;
}
#top{
float:left;
width:800px;
height:104px;
}

#but_place{
float:left;
clear:both;
width:800px;
height:181px;
background-image:url(../images/button_placer.png);
}

#buttons{
float:left;
text-align:center;
margin:0 0 0 250px;
font-size:14px;
color:#382717;
width:240px;
letter-spacing:normal;
}
#buttons a{
color:#333;
font-weight:bold;
text-decoration:none;
}

#buttons a:hover{
text-decoration:underline;
}

ul{
padding: 5px;
margin: 0;
}

ul li{
list-style-type:none;
margin:0 0 0 10px;
font-weight:bold;
padding:9px 5px 2px 5px;
border-bottom:1px dotted #000;
}


#but_place_down{
float:left;
clear:both;
width:800px;
height:303px;
background-image:url(../images/small_desc.png);
font-weight:bold;
}

#but_place_down_txt1{
float:left;
margin:3px 0 0 330px;
}
#but_place_down_txt2{
float:left;
clear:both;
margin:0 0 0 170px;
text-align:center;
width:400px;
font-family:"Times New Roman", Times, serif;
}
#but_place_down_txt3{
float:left;
clear:both;
margin:14px 0 0 200px;
text-align:center;
width:350px;
line-height:14px;
font-weight:bold;
}

#butseparator{
float:left;
clear:both;
margin:0 0 0 240px;
}

#haveinform{
float:left;
clear:both;
width:350px;
text-align:center;
margin:8px 0 0 200px;
font-size:18px;
line-height:18px;
}
#earnup{
float:left;
clear:both;
width:350px;
text-align:center;
margin:10px 0 0 200px;
font-size:13px;
line-height:16px;
}


#mid_sep{
float:left;
clear:both;
width:800px;
}

#mid{
float:left;
clear:both;
margin:-5px 0 0 0;
width:800px;
}

#midleft{
float:left;
width:450px;
}

#left1{
float:left;
width:450px;
height:546px;
background-image:url(../images/left1.png);
}
#left1_con{
float:left;
margin:18px 0 0 60px;
font-size:11px;
font-weight:bold;
line-height:12px;
}

#left2{
float:left;
clear:both;
width:450px;
height:275px;
background-image:url(../images/left2.png);
}


#midright{
float:left;
width:350px;
}
#right1{
float:left;
width:350px;
height:618px;
background-image:url(../images/right1.png);
}
#right1_con{
float:left;
clear:both;
}
#right1_con_head{
float:left;
margin:20px 0 0 35px;
}
#fillform{
float:left;
clear:both;
margin:10px 0 0 52px;
font-size:14px;
}
#fname{
float:left;
width:300px;
}
#fnametxt{
float:left;
width:69px;
}
#fnamefrm{
float:left;
margin:0 0 0 5px;
}

#lname{
float:left;
clear:both;
margin:5px 0 0 0;
width:300px;
}
#lnametxt{
float:left;
width:67px;
}
#lnamefrm{
float:left;
margin:0 0 0 7px;
}

#ph{
float:left;
clear:both;
margin:5px 0 0 0;
width:300px;
}
#phtxt{
float:left;
width:98px;
}
#phfrm{
float:left;
margin:0 0 0 5px;
}

#mail{
float:left;
clear:both;
margin:5px 0 0 0;
width:300px;
}
#mailtxt{
float:left;
width:45px;
}
#mailfrm{
float:left;
margin:0 0 0 5px;
}

#confirm{
float:left;
clear:both;
margin:5px 0 0 0;
width:300px;
}
#confirmtxt{
float:left;
width:300px;
}
#confirmfrm{
float:left;
margin:0 0 0 5px;
}


#comment{
float:left;
clear:both;
margin:5px 0 0 0;
width:300px;
}
#commenttxt{
float:left;
width:300px;
}
#commentfrm{
float:left;
clear:both;
margin:5px 0 0 0;
}

#subbtn{
float:left;
clear:both;
margin:2px 0 0 42px;
}


#as_seen{
float:left;
clear:both;
margin:15px 0 0 50px;
}

#right2{
float:left;
width:350px;
height:203px;
background-image:url(../images/right2.png);
}

#foot_btn{
width:370px;
text-align:center;
font-size:13px;
line-height:30px;
}

#foot_btn a{
color:#333;
font-weight:bold;
text-decoration:none;
}

#foot_btn a:hover{
text-decoration:underline;
}